Our centre on Brock University’s tranquil and green campus offers amazing facilities for our students, including modern classrooms, a state-of-the-art computer lab, vast library for study time, healthy-living cafeteria, firepit/bonfire and a student lounge.
Brock University is in the heart of the Niagara region, home to natural beauty and world famous attractions. It’s just minutes away from one of the Wonders of the World, Niagara Falls, and Toronto, the biggest city in Canada, is just 45 minutes away. Sports lovers can enjoy the campus pool, gym, basketball courts, soccer and rugby fields, baseball diamond, climbing wall and hiking trails, just to name a few.
